The Kalispel Market Team member is a multi-tasked position. This position greets our guests (customers), complete sales transactions, and other duties as necessary to ensure our guests have great experience.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
- Operational Adherence: Follow cash handling procedures. Greet guests, complete sales transactions, and perform other duties as necessary to ensure a smoothly run shift while maintaining a sincere, caring and personable image for the guest and team. Maintain organizational standards of quality, service, cleanliness and sanitation and safety.
- Maintain product knowledge: Know the products, presentations, and prices of all products and specials.
- Complete cleaning and stocking (restocking) duties in accordance with the appropriate daily operating procedure.
- Prepare and/or restock any necessary fresh condiments.
- Responsible for the proper use of gloves, utensils, and portion size of each item, including temperature of all products, and the quality presentation of all products.
- Greet guests. Engage in additional conversation with guest while performing duties. Assist other stations when able.
- Greet, check in, and check out RV Park guests as they arrive and depart. Charge and instruct guests regarding RV dump procedures as well and responsible for the proper dispensing of LPG from main tanks. (This only applies to Kalispel Market Cusick location)
- Opening, Shift Change and Closing: Perform cleaning, set-up and breakdown duties as directed by management and position requirements.
- Ensure inventory control/protection of organizational assets.
- Available and willing to work any changes in hours deemed necessary for Business Levels.
- Responsible for maintaining a consistent, regular good attendance record.

Experience
- Six months of related experience is preferred.
- Must be computer literate with working knowledge of Microsoft programs and cash processing software.
- Ability to handle cash accurately
- Delivery of outstanding, attentive, and friendly service to customers.
- Requires ability to operate a 10 key.
- Ability to handle stress, remain calm and courteous and handle a wide variety of clientele.
- Ability to maintain effective working relationships with department heads, team members,
- Ability to work with mathematical concepts such as fractions, percentages, and ratios to practical solutions.
- Excellent organ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ills.
- Skill in solving practical problems and dealing with situations where only limited standardization exists.
- Able to perform minimal troubleshooting on basic equipment used in essential job functions.
- Employment is contingent upon favorable outcome of background investigation and drug screen.
- High school diploma or general education degree (GED) preferred.
- Ability to obtain and maintain a Kalispel Tribal Work Permit.
- Minimum age requirement of 18 years old.
- Payment Card Training.
- Valid health card.
- Hepatitis A & B vaccination.
- Washington State Food Handler Permit within 14 days of start.
- Mandatory Alcohol Server Training (MAST) certification.
- Available and willing to work any changes in hours deemed necessary for business levels.
- Participate in MASTRVP Program.

Hiring Preference
The Kalispel Tribe of Indians is an Equal opportunity employer. Consistent with federal law, the Kalispel Tribe of Indians applies Indian preference in employment. It is the policy of the Kalispel Tribe of Indians to give preference in hiring, promotions, and transfers into vacant positions to qualified applicants in the following order: 1) Kalispel Tribal Members; 2) Spouses of an enrolled Kalispel Tribal Member; 3) enrolled members of other Indian Tribes; 4) all other applicants.
